Risk Description
The products pose a chemical risk because the leather of the lining and insole of the shoes contain: (model FY151-1) up to 30.1 mg/kg of Chromium (VI); and (model FY151-2) up to 40.2 mg/kg. Chromium (VI) is classified as sensitising and may trigger allergic reactions.The products do not comply with the relevant national standard UNE 17075:2008.
Product Description
Ladies’ shoes with synthetic uppers and soles. Packaging: cardboard boxes showing the model, colour and size.
